Please find the schematic below. Can an electronic expert explain to me the exact function. Input is ~300VDC at R7. The unit works as expected and smoothly ramps up to 280VDC in about 5-6s, nice. The R7/C7 (R10/C8) function I do understand, it’s time delayed charge of the capacitors which slowly starts the conduction of the regulator mosfets. What is the function of D4/D5 and R9?
Q2: I setup a simulation on LTSpice which stops with a Too Small Time Step, blah, blah, blah after 5.8s. Any advice about the correct LTSpice settings. I suspect this behavior has something to do with the zeners…

I'm not the brightest bulb here but this is a capacitor multiplier.Zenners are for Gate-drain voltage protection( usually 12..18v zenners) .r9 and r7 sets a voltage for the first gate with t9 discharging the first gate after shut down alowing also for a predictable slow start startup.
Zenners could be replaced with fixed dc voltage sources with r series around 10 ohms but I suspect your mosfets need a 12...18 volts zenner as for the sim to work try also a generic mosfet instead a specific one if the 18v zenner doesn't do the job.
